About iDriveSoCal
iDriveSoCal is a Southern California-based media company dedicated to celebrating the driving lifestyle, car shows, automotive news, and everything that makes cruising SoCal roads unforgettable. Founded by Tom Smith, we've built a loyal audience through our website, ---------- , which serves as the central hub for all our content, and our weekly newsletter, which has grown to over 21,000 subscribers with a 45% open rate and 14% click-through rate—proving our content resonates deeply.

Our social media channels have huge untapped potential: Currently, we have modest follower counts with plenty of room for strategic growth. We're not chasing trends like heavy EV coverage; instead, we focus on gas-powered fun and community events. But we also keep our audience aware of the latest happening in automotive innovation. We seamlessly integrate content across platforms—using website articles in the newsletter and vice versa to maximize engagement. As our Social Media Manager, you'll be key to turning this into a thriving online community, with a primary focus on driving newsletter subscriptions, secondary emphasis on expanding content reach, and tertiary goal of growing likes and follows.

Job Responsibilities
You'll work closely with founder Tom Smith to shape and execute our social strategy, especially in the early months for hands-on collaboration and training. Key responsibilities include:
--Video Creation and Editing:
--Create and edit videos for social media and other online consumption.
--Create reels from our library of still images with genre-appropriate music.
--Create reels with captions from on-camera video and Zoom interviews.
--Combine on-camera green screen commentary with reels and videos.
--General video editing as needed, including promotional and TV news-style formats.
--Planning and Executing Social Media Posts:
--In collaboration with iDSC founder, Tom Smith.
--Plan, schedule, and execute social media posts on all primary US platforms.
--Primary platforms: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, and X (Twitter).
--Secondary platforms: YouTube, Rumble, LinkedIn, and Pinterest.
--Use strategic tags to optimize reach and growth.
--Adjust and edit posts as needed.
--Constantly monitor metrics on all posts and plan for future success, tying efforts to key goals like newsletter sign-ups and content amplification.

Additional Tasks:
--Graphic design for social media posts and other uses.
--Library management: Tag and organize image and video assets.
--Team collaboration: Communicate with the team on content plans and improvements.
--Forever improvement: Stay on the cutting edge of social media expertise and opportunities to grow iDriveSoCal’s audience.

Expect a full-time schedule (40 hours/week) during regular Pacific Standard Time business hours, Monday through Friday, with flexibility focused on results. We'll track success through metrics newsletter sign ups, referral traffic, engagement rates, and audience growth.
